Abstract

A transdermally absorbable base material including: a lipid peptide compound including at least one of compound of Formula (1) below and the similar compounds or pharmaceutically usable salts thereof; a surfactant; a specific polyhydric alcohol; a fatty acid; and water, wherein R 1 is a C 9-23 aliphatic group; R 2 is a hydrogen atom or a C 1-4 alkyl group that optionally has a branched chain having a carbon atom number of 1 or 2; R 3 is a —(CH 2 ) n —X group; n is a number of 1 to 4; and X is amino group, guanidino group, —CONH 2 group, or a 5-membered cyclic group optionally having 1 to 3 nitrogen atoms, a 6-membered cyclic group optionally having 1 to 3 nitrogen atoms, or a condensed heterocyclic group constituted by a 5-membered cyclic group and a 6-membered cyclic group which optionally have 1 to 3 nitrogen atoms.

1 . A transdermally absorbable base material comprising:
 a lipid peptide compound including at least one of compounds of Formulae (1) to (3) below or pharmaceutically usable salts thereof;   a surfactant;   1,2-alkanediol or glycerin;   at least one fatty acid; and   water,   
       
         
           
           
               
               
           
         
         (wherein R 1  is a C 9-23  aliphatic group; R 2  is a hydrogen atom or a C 1-4  alkyl group that optionally has a branched chain having a carbon atom number of 1 or 2; R 3  is a —(CH 2 ) n —X group; n is a number of 1 to 4; and X is amino group, guanidino group, —CONH 2  group, or a 5-membered cyclic group optionally having 1 to 3 nitrogen atoms, a 6-membered cyclic group optionally having 1 to 3 nitrogen atoms, or a condensed heterocyclic group constituted by a 5-membered cyclic group and a 6-membered cyclic group which optionally have 1 to 3 nitrogen atoms.) 
       
       
         
           
           
               
               
           
         
         (wherein R 4  is a C 9-23  aliphatic group; R 5  to R 7  are each independently a hydrogen atom, a C 1-4  alkyl group that optionally has a branched chain having a carbon atom number of 1 or 2, or —(CH 2 ) n —X group; n is a number of 1 to 4; and X is amino group, guanidino group, —CONH 2  group, or a 5-membered cyclic group optionally having 1 to 3 nitrogen atoms, a 6-membered cyclic group optionally having 1 to 3 nitrogen atoms, or a condensed heterocyclic group constituted by a 5-membered cyclic group and a 6-membered cyclic group which optionally have 1 to 3 nitrogen atoms.) 
       
       
         
           
           
               
               
           
         
         (wherein R 8  is a C 9-23  aliphatic group; R 9  to R 12  are each independently a hydrogen atom, a C 1-4  alkyl group that optionally has a branched chain having a carbon atom number of 1 or 2, or —(CH 2 ) n —X group; n is a number of 1 to 4; and X is amino group, guanidino group, —CONH 2  group, or a 5-membered cyclic group optionally having 1 to 3 nitrogen atoms, a 6-membered cyclic group optionally having 1 to 3 nitrogen atoms, or a condensed heterocyclic group constituted by a 5-membered cyclic group and a 6-membered cyclic group which optionally have 1 to 3 nitrogen atoms.) 
       
     
     
         2 . The transdermally absorbable base material according to  claim 1 , wherein the lipid peptide compound is a compound of Formula (1), wherein R 1  is a linear aliphatic group having a carbon atom number of 15; R 2  is a hydrogen atom; and R 3  is 4-imidazole methyl group. 
     
     
         3 . The transdermally absorbable base material according to  claim 1 , being stick-shaped. 
     
     
         4 . The transdermally absorbable base material according to  claim 1 , further comprising at least one oleaginous base material. 
     
     
         5 . The transdermally absorbable base material according to an one of  claim 1 , further comprising at least one organic acid. 
     
     
         6 . The transdermally absorbable base material according to  claim 1 , comprising, as the surfactant, at least one compound selected from the group consisting of ethylene glycol alkyl ethers, phospholipid, and polyglycerin fatty acid esters. 
     
     
         7 . The transdermally absorbable base material according to  claim 1 , further comprising polyoxyethylene (20) sorbitan monolaurate (CAS registry number 9005-64-5) as the surfactant. 
     
     
         8 . The transdermally absorbable base material according to  claim 1 , wherein the fatty acid is stearic acid. 
     
     
         9 . The transdermally absorbable base material according to  claim 5 , wherein the organic acid is at least one selected from the group consisting of oxalic acid, citric acid, and ascorbic acid. 
     
     
         10 . The transdermally absorbable base material according to  claim 1 , being used for cosmetics or pharmaceutical products.
